Lovely 1926 Sesquicentennial
Quarter Eagle, MS65

1926 $2 1/2 Sesquicentennial MS65 PCGS. CAC. The low-relief Sesquicentennial gold quarter eagles and silver half dollars are telling demonstrations of why coinage design by committee usually turns out badly. After more than three-quarters of the original mintage failed to sell and was relegated to the melting pots, it would be another 58 years before America would issue a commemorative gold piece--the 1984 Olympic Games ten dollar.
This lovely Gem piece, on the other hand, should prove extremely popular with bidders, given its pristine surfaces, a bold strike for the issue, and lack of even the remotest distraction.(Registry values: N2998)

Metal: 90% Gold, 10% Copper
Weight: 4.18 grams
AGW: 0.12095oz
Mintage: 46,019
